Ordinals
beta
Address 1HgR7knML2pvubCd1bgssU5RJuBZfCKywk
sat balance
121863
runes balances
outputs
6f58c20a58ecd797b56aa60cd6ec02d27ca7794eca80d8fecc66074e86762093:0